Listen Cowboys Nation, I know everyone is irritated , annoyed, pissed off, ETC.

But I see a bunch of ridiculousness. The fact of the matter is... this team just got rolled over. If you paid attention I said TEAM. Coaching and players.

If I were to put an assessment on this game, I would put more of the failings upon the coaching staff. Yes I will give Garrett credit. He was gutsy, took risks. Went for it on fourth down when needed. I will give him that.

The coordinators.. now that's a different story.
Sure you can blame the defense for giving up over 250 yards rushing. Guess what they were on the field for over 36 minutes of the game. Oh, they also played nickel for most the game. I love Kris Richard but he played nickel way too much. Jared Goff had a 53% completion percentage and 186 yards. How about playing more base, stopping the run and forcing Goff to beat you from the pocket. At least I could live with Goff beating us.

As for Scott Linehan, you have to go my man. If you are a coordinator in the NFL, and are simply stubborn enough to say, "this is what we do and we will line up and try to beat you every game," then you are not good sir. Look at Sean McVay he ran a jet sweep motion maybe 7-10 times throughout the game. He was patient enough to let that work until he needed it (Robert woods jet sweep). I simply do not believe Scott Linehan "schemed" anything in particular for this rams defense. That is flat out embarrassing.

Dak Prescott is not the future of the cowboys. Say what you want about his "leadership, toughness, intangibles" whatever. All that is just fluffer in my mind. The guy is inaccurate, he does not anticipate, and after 3 years in the league he still has some of the worst footwork in the NFL. You know what "leadership" is??? Leadership is a damn baller. Leadership is Aaron Rodgers. You think anyone likes Aaron Rodgers off the field? Hell no. He's a weirdo, but guess what he gets it done. The cowboys will extend Dak, and the cowboys will be in purgatory until he fixes his issues.

The definition of insanity is to doing the same thing over and over again, and expecting a different result. That is the definition of the Cowboys. The NFL is a diverse league. Different players, different coaches, different schemes. In order
To succeed you must be able to scheme and game plan accordingly. That is not what happened tonight. The cowboys are good enough to "do what they do" and make the playoffs. But as you can see they will never make a deep run if they continue to "do what they do."


My point is, everyone on this forum will point out the obvious without putting anything into context. Sure blame the defense, without pointing out they were on the field for over 36 minutes. Sure blame zeke, when he didn't have any running lanes, any special schemes runs.

Let's give blame to the real problem. Coaching is very important in this league. The cowboys have a very talented roster but without coaching it is mush. The point of coaching is to put your players in the best possible position to succeed, and they simply didn't do that tonight.

The Dallas Cowboys got beat at there own game by a team that I think, position to position isn't better than them. If you go position by position, talent for talent I don't think the Rams are better than the cowboys. If they are, it's not by much.

Like I said, this comes back to a failure in the coaching staff. I hope they can get a good OC this offseason with someone that can fix Dak's issues. If not this will be the story every year.
